I believe you are hearing NYS Parks @ Bear Mountain, NY who has a patch between VHF and their Rockland Co talkgroup. .
That's certainly possible, as 154.890 (151.4 PL) is Bear Mountain's primary VHF frequency. Has been for decades, in fact. And yes, there is a full-time patch in place between that repeater and TG 2121 on the RCPSCS that was put online a few years ago.

The repeater is up on top of Perkins Memorial Tower in Bear Mtn. Very high site that gets out strong for dozens of miles all around.

Very easy to identify them. Dispatcher is "Bear Mountain" and the cars are all 8Fxx, or sometimes abbreviated 86x for the Rangers (they drop the F, but technically they're all 8F6x).

If you have a Phase II capable scanner, listen to the RCPSCS TG 2121 and see if the audio matches up.
